These include both evolutionary (survival) and psychosocial sources … Webb15 mars 2006 · Gestalt principles are much like heuristics, which are mental shortcuts for solving problems. ... The law of prägnanz is sometimes referred to as the law of good figure or the law of simplicity. This law holds that when you're presented with a set of ambiguous or complex objects, your brain will make them appear as simple as possible.

WebbIn UX, the heuristic analysis is considered a usability method for finding usability problems in a user interface design. This involves a set of evaluators who are to examine the interface and to critique its usability based on the recognized usability principles.
